Witryna23 godz. temu · Unfortunately, Tylenol may not be the best idea. Recent research has found strong evidence that acetaminophen (Tylenol) reduces the effectiveness of certain anti-cancer drugs, leading to poor outcomes in some cancer patients. More specifically, acetaminophen may inhibit immunotherapy drugs called immune checkpoint inhibitors. Witryna17 gru 2024 · Immunotherapy with checkpoint inhibitors has revolutionized cancer therapy and is now the standard treatment for several different types of cancer, … WitrynaInfusion reactions can happen when your body has a strong immune response to a cancer treatment that's given intravenously (IV). The types of drugs used in these cancer treatments can be chemotherapy, targeted therapy, or immunotherapy. The process of giving the treatment might be called an IV infusion, injection, or push.
